Tea Tree — often sold under its botanical name, Melaleuca — is the oil most people meet first. It contains over ninety distinct compounds, and doTERRA sources it from Australia and Kenya, where the growing conditions are close enough to give a consistent oil. In Europe it is a topical and aromatic oil, valued for cleansing and for the fresh, sharp, slightly medicinal aroma that makes a room feel just-cleaned.

What it smells like

Medicinal, green and slightly camphorous — the smell people either take to immediately or never quite do. It is not a perfume oil. It smells of the thing it is, which in a cleaning cupboard is an advantage.

Three things to actually do with it

1. A bathroom and bin spray

Eight drops with four of lemon in 250 ml of water and a small squeeze of unscented washing-up liquid. The lemon does the work of making it bearable. Shake before use.

2. A spot blend at 1 %

Three drops in 10 ml of jojoba, applied with a cotton bud rather than a finger. Jojoba rather than coconut because it sits better on skin that is already oily. Patch test on the inner forearm and wait a day before it goes near a face.

3. On the washing-up brush and the bin lid

A drop on the brush head between washes, a drop under the bin lid when the bag is changed. Neither is a disinfectant claim — it is a smell, doing what smells do.

What it blends with

Citrus, above all — lemon and wild orange both round it off far better than you would expect. Lavender softens it in a skin blend. Eucalyptus reinforces the medicinal side rather than balancing it.

Getting the amount right

In the European range this oil is supplied for topical and aromatic use and is not labelled as a food flavouring — it does not go in food or drink, in any amount. Dilute on skin: 1 % for general use, less on the face. It is not photosensitising.

Tea tree oxidises with time and air, and oxidised tea tree is noticeably more irritating than fresh. Keep it capped, dark and cool, and replace it rather than finishing a bottle that has gone sharp. Full safety notes.

Questions people ask

Can I use it neat on a spot?

It is the most common thing people do with tea tree and the most common way they end up sensitised to it. One drop in a teaspoon of carrier does the same job without the risk.

Is it safe around cats?

Do not apply it to a cat, and give any animal in a diffused room a way to leave. Cats metabolise these compounds poorly.

Why does mine smell harsher than it used to?

Oxidation. It is a sign the bottle has aged, not that the oil was different when you bought it.
